A day to honor those who died in our military service, Mayor Craig A. Moe has announced that City and Passport Offices will be closed on Monday, May 31, 2021, in observance of Memorial Day.This will mean a change in the trash and recycling schedule for the week of May 30th:
- Monday’s Residential and Commercial Refuse and Recycling will be picked up on Tuesday, June 1st.
- Tuesday’s Residential Refuse and Recycling will be picked up on Wednesday, June 2nd.
- Wednesday, Thursday and Friday Refuse, Recycling and Composting pickups will be unchanged.
- There will be no Special Bulky Item pickups or Yard Debris pickups that Wednesday on June 2nd.
The next regularly scheduled Special Bulky Item pickup and Yard Debris collections will be on Wednesday, June 9th.
